In a world full of distractions it’s so crucial that we equip ourselves with tools and disciplines to navigate the terrain that we are forced to live in. In order to fulfill your purpose and live out your destiny you have to be focused and prioritize the things of God. In Matthew 6:33 Jesus says “But seek ye first the kingdom of God, and his righteousness; and all these things shall be added unto you.” If you notice at the beginning of his statement he is calling us to focus on the kingdom above all things… And we can’t do that distracted, so let’s get into this conversation today!
